Can you move to a smaller apartment in the same complex?
Talk to Your Property Manager: Before you can move, you have to find out if there is an available unit within your complex. You may need to be placed on a waiting list if another apartment isn’t available, or you may have to jump on an apartment before someone else claims it.

Can I transfer apartment lease?
Answer. Under a typical lease assignment, you transfer all of your space to someone else for the entire remaining term of the lease, and the new tenant pays rent directly to the landlord. Have a conversation with your landlord about allowing you to assign your lease to a new tenant.

Can a person move from one apartment to another?
The first thing the landlord is going to think about is getting your old unit ready to rent out to someone else. It’s not so much the issue of you moving to another unit, it is the time and money that is going to have to be spent, by the landlord, to get your unit ready to rent out again.
